Subject: Quickstore 4.2 — bloom filter now fronts the KV layer

Plugin authors: starting with this release, Quickstore places a bloom filter ahead of the key-value store. Negative lookups return faster; false positives fall through safely. No API changes are required on your side. Verify your plugin against the staging build referenced below.

session token of fahif-tadup = htk3_9c7

**TICKET SNP-874: EXIF scrubber config drifted — some uploads keeping metadata**

Heads up, support folks: a few customers noticed GPS tags surviving in photos uploaded through Snapthorn. Turns out the scrubber nodes drifted from the intended config after a hotfix — two of them reverted to a mode that only strips camera make/model. We're redeploying tonight; until then, tell affected customers to re-upload after the fix lands. For reference, the settings currently running on the drifted nodes are these.

service settings:
PRAIX_LOG_LEVEL=error
PRAIX_METRICS_HOST=metrics.praix.qorvelcorp.corp
PRAIX_POOL_SIZE=16

Subject: Transition to Annual Billing — Guidance for Branches

To the executive team: following the review led by Marta Quillen, Fenbrook Systems will migrate all Veltrace subscriptions to annual billing from next quarter. Branch managers should prepare customer communications carefully, verify renewal dates, and flag any accounts on legacy monthly terms to regional finance before cutover. Full procedures follow next week. The strategic rationale is summarised in the note below.

management briefing: Jorixax Holdings is in early talks to buy Casixax Holdings for about $420.3 million. The Fenmir launch date is October 27, and nothing goes to the press before then. Legal wants the Keloxek Foods term sheet redrafted before April 16.

Ticket #— Floor 9 Opening Prep, Brindlemoor House

Hi facilities folks, Floor 9 opens to staff next Monday and we need a few things squared away before then. Lift access is live, but the two side doors by the kitchenette are still on the old lock config — please reprogram them before Friday. Also, signage for the quiet rooms hasn't arrived, so pop up the temporary printed ones for now. Until the badge readers sync, the interim door code for Floor 9 is below.

door code, bajop-bajog: bdg-DSWAC-43621